#60455d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#60455d is composed of 37.6% red, 27.1% green and 36.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 28.1% magenta, 3.1% yellow and 62.4% black. It has a hue angle of 306.7 degrees, a saturation of 16.4% and a lightness of 32.4%. #60455d color hex could be obtained by blending #c08aba with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663366.

Shades and Tints of #60455d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050305 is the darkest color, while #faf8fa is the lightest one.
